Roof flashing repair services involve inspecting and fixing the metal strips installed around roof features such as chimneys, vents, skylights, and edges. These metal strips, known as flashing, serve as a barrier to direct water away from vulnerable areas of the roof and prevent leaks. Over time, flashing can become damaged, corroded, or improperly installed, leading to gaps or cracks that allow water to seep into the roof structure. Repairing or replacing damaged flashing helps maintain the roof’s integrity and protects the interior of the property from water damage.

Problems that roof flashing repair can address often include water stains on ceilings or walls, mold growth, and signs of water infiltration around roof penetrations. Common causes of flashing issues include weather exposure, age, or poor initial installation. When flashing is compromised, it can cause leaks during heavy rain or snowmelt, resulting in costly repairs if left unaddressed. Local contractors specializing in flashing repair can assess the extent of damage, recommend appropriate solutions, and ensure that the flashing functions effectively to keep the roof watertight.

What is roof flashing, and why is it important? Roof flashing is a material installed around roof joints, valleys, and chimneys to prevent water from seeping into the structure. Proper flashing helps protect the roof from leaks and water damage.

How do I know if my roof flashing needs repair? Signs include visible rust, cracked or missing flashing, water stains on ceilings, or water pooling around roof penetrations. An inspection by a local contractor can confirm if repairs are needed.

What types of materials are used for roof flashing repair? Common materials include aluminum, copper, galvanized steel, and lead. The choice depends on the roof type, exposure, and existing flashing materials.

Can damaged roof flashing cause leaks? Yes, compromised flashing can allow water to penetrate the roof, leading to leaks and potential structural issues if not repaired promptly.

How do local contractors handle roof flashing repairs? They typically inspect the affected areas, remove damaged flashing, and install new, properly sealed flashing to ensure water tightness and durability.
